            Road cases are always essential especially for music artists, DJs or bands that are often on the go. Moving around with musical instruments is usually inexorable for many musicians but comes with the risks of having some of your instruments damaged particularly if proper safety measures are not put in place when transporting them. Given the size and nature of most musical instruments, it is hardly possible to fully guarantee their safety while on the move. Well not unless you put them on a road case.<br /><br />Road cases are normally made from sturdy materials that cannot expose the instruments inside to any kind of damage irrespective of external conditions. There are many types of road safety cases. Some cases are designed for DJ turntables whereas others are designed to transport DJ workstations, mixers and even party head lights. Therefore you will have to be a little more particular on the kind of road case you need while shopping. On the other hand, if you have a lot of things to carry with you, you can choose to spend your money on cases that are meant for carrying All-in-one stations. All in all, your musical instruments will be safer when on a road case so ensure you get yourself the right road cases before your next travel.
